A Fool In The Forest,
by Basil Burwell


New York: The Macmillan Company, (1963). 
First edition, this copy inscribed, signed & dated in ink by the author, who adds a small sketch of a mouse, at the first blank page. Octavo (8.75" x 6"), 430 pages. Publisher's light blue cloth lettered in plum on the spine, in pictorial dust jacket. Gunn/ Gay American Novels, 1870–1970: p. 104. 

Condition: Upper margin & spine extremities sunned, edges lightly rubbed, text slightly toned & occasionally foxed, about Very Good in moderately rubbed dust jacket with short tears & small losses mostly at the top & bottom of the spine, Good or better. Please see photos.


Partially autobiographical, the novel centers around young Jeff Ramsey & his "unsentimental education" in "the gay, tawdry, amoral, sometimes brutal world of a seedy summer stock company." Author Burwell was himself an actor & director as well as the founder of The Belfast Maskers in Belfast, Maine.
